Ipswich Open Talks To Sign Daizen Maeda From Celtic

Maeda has pushed for a Premier League move and Celtic face pressure to sell before his contract expires.

Overview

  • Reports say Ipswich have formally opened talks and submitted an approach for Daizen Maeda, with the club keen to conclude a quick transfer.
  • Maeda has publicly said he wants to play in the Premier League and told Japanese TV that a lower asking price would make a move easier.
  • Celtic are understood to be willing to sell this summer rather than risk losing Maeda for free next year because he is in the final year of his contract.
  • Some outlets report an initial offer structure discussed between the clubs that starts around £8m and could rise to about £10m with add-ons, but no deal has been confirmed.
  • Ipswich are also pursuing free agent Hidemasa Morita and the club’s targeted recruitment of Japanese internationals follows Maeda’s raised profile after the World Cup, a development that could boost Portman Road attendances and squad depth.
